Get the Dreambox converter from www.lik-sang.com and you won't be sorry. Try and use it with a PSOne Dual Shock if you can. If not, make sure you press the ANALOG button on your PS2 Dual Shock as soon as turn on the Xbox. This will help prevent any button lag.

The BLACK button on the Xbox pad is hopeless for Winning Eleven since to position yourself for volleys you need to hold it and press shoot at the same time. And unless you have two thumbs on your right hand, that's pretty much impossible.

I have a converter but not sure of the name, but the only thing that I don't like about it is that the black/white buttons on xbox translate into the r2/l2 buttons on the ps2 controller. I'd rather have it map to r1/l1. Do all the converters do this or are there exceptions?

Other than that, the converter is great. No lag issues between button press and action on the Xbox.
